BMW R1300R: the German boxer becomes a sporty hypernaked bike

BMW

BMW has redesigned its benchmark naked bike, and it has done so decisively. The R 1300 R represents the sporty evolution of the previous 1250R, bringing the famous twin-cylinder boxer engine that also powers the GS family to the road, but with a completely different vocation.

One glance is enough to understand the philosophy behind this bike: taut lines, aggressive geometry and a sleek tail immediately reveal the sporty soul of the project. It is no longer just a versatile naked bike, but a true hypernaked ready to take on the sharpest rivals in the segment.

The numbers speak for themselves: 145 horsepower and 149 Nm of torque guarantee high-level performance. But what really sets the R 1300 R apart is its sophisticated chassis. The DSA (Dynamic Suspension Adjustment) system allows electronic control of both the front fork hydraulics and the rear monoshock, even managing the spring rate of the fork. This racing-derived technology allows the dynamic behaviour of the bike to be adapted to different conditions of use and riding styles.

However, the R 1300 R is not an isolated model: it is part of a larger family that offers the 1,300 cc boxer engine in different configurations, including the even sportier RS sister model. BMW thus demonstrates its desire to dominate every segment of the premium naked bike market with cutting-edge technical solutions.
